技术文摘
mysql.server:MySQL服务器启动脚本
mysql.server:MySQL服务器启动脚本
在MySQL数据库的管理与运维中,mysql.server这个启动脚本扮演着至关重要的角色。它是运维人员和开发者频繁打交道的工具,深刻理解它有助于更高效地管理MySQL服务器。
mysql.server本质上是一个Shell脚本,其主要功能是启动、停止、重启MySQL服务器进程。这个脚本的存在,极大简化了MySQL服务器的日常操作流程。当我们需要启动MySQL服务器时,只需在命令行中输入对应的启动命令,mysql.server脚本就会按照预设的步骤,完成服务器的启动操作。
在不同的Linux发行版中,mysql.server脚本的位置可能有所不同。在常见的系统中,它通常位于/etc/init.d/目录下。找到这个脚本所在位置后,我们就可以对MySQL服务器进行相应的控制。
以启动服务器为例,我们在终端中输入“sudo /etc/init.d/mysql.server start”命令(这里以Ubuntu系统为例,不同系统命令可能略有差异),脚本会首先检查MySQL相关的配置文件是否正确,确保各项参数设置无误后,尝试启动MySQL服务进程。如果过程中出现任何错误,脚本会返回相应的错误信息,方便我们排查问题。
而停止服务器时,使用“sudo /etc/init.d/mysql.server stop”命令,脚本会向MySQL服务进程发送停止信号,安全地关闭MySQL服务器,确保数据的完整性。重启命令则是“sudo /etc/init.d/mysql.server restart”,它结合了停止和启动的操作,在一些需要更新配置或处理临时故障时非常实用。
mysql.server脚本还具备一定的日志记录功能。它会将启动、停止过程中的关键信息记录到特定的日志文件中,这些日志对于分析服务器运行状况、排查潜在问题提供了有力的支持。
熟练掌握mysql.server这个MySQL服务器启动脚本,能够显著提升MySQL数据库的运维效率,保障数据库的稳定运行。无论是初学者还是经验丰富的开发者,都值得深入研究和运用这个强大的工具。
TAGS: MySQL 启动脚本 MySQL服务器 mysql.server
- Python 开源爬虫网站 助你秒搜豆瓣好书
- 生态系统内 550 多家公司入局 VR 春天是否已至?
- 童心制物两大编程新品,布局儿童编程教育激发孩子创造力
- 前端工程师必备的图片知识
- 在 Python 游戏中添加敌人的方法
- 架构设计的五个核心要素是什么
- 日均 7 亿交易量下 MySQL 高可用架构的设计之道
- 阿里工程师盘点异常检测的多种方法
- 中国移动耿亮:边缘计算助力 5G 绽放精彩
- 浅议 Cgroups
- 30 岁以上构建微服务的顶级工具一览
- 中国移动韩柳燕:SPN 进展达预期,构建“健壮”产业链
- 自动编码器的前世今生全解析
- Flutter Web 初体验:或将致前端开发者失业的技术
- 在 Python 中运用 singledispatch 追溯添加方法